Explore the profound and complex history of slavery in the Americas with "Slavery in the Americas" by Herbert S. Klein. Published by Ivan R Dee in 1989, this insightful paperback spans 284 pages, offering an in-depth examination of the institutional differences in slavery between two pivotal New World colonies: Virginia and Cuba. Klein's meticulous analysis highlights the distinct social, economic, and cultural impacts of slavery in North America compared to those in Latin America. This book is an essential read for anyone interested in African American Studies, general history, and the enduring legacy of slavery and emancipation in the Americas.
